Sentences with GLARING

Check out our example sentences below to help you understand the context.

Sentences

1
"The glaring sun made it difficult to see."
2
"Her glaring mistake was obvious to everyone."
3
"The glaring headlines caught my attention."
4
"He couldn't ignore the glaring problem any longer."
5
"The glaring colors of the painting were too vibrant for my taste."
6
"The glaring error in the report was embarrassing."
7
"The glaring neon sign was hard to miss."
8
"The glaring contradiction in his statement raised suspicions."
9
"She gave me a glaring look of disapproval."
10
"The glaring omission in the book's plot left readers disappointed."
